Job description

Vynyl’s technologists, designers and product strategists are experts at system modernization, new product development, and rescuing projects in distress. We use the best cloud-native and AI-enabled tools, and apply a battle-tested combination of Agile, Lean, and design thinking to collaboratively solve our client’s most pressing challenges - and do it right the first time. We often work in regulated industries, such as healthcare, financial services, government and education. Our work helps detect diseases, identify kids who need special educational support, applies AI to support complex legal settlements, helps people access mental health services, and so much more.

The Role

As a Project Manager, you’ll lead cross-functional software teams from discovery through launch and iteration. The work will span from modernizations and stabilizing "project rescues" to developing exciting new products. A significant portion of our work involves cutting‑edge AI and data initiatives, including AI‑native and enabled product experiences, data platform and integration work, and analytics/automation that turn insights into impact. You’ll keep scope, schedule, budget, risk, and quality in balance while keeping clients confident and informed.

What You’ll Do
  • Manage end-to-end delivery across multiple engagements, agile ceremonies, roadmaps, and iterative releases with measurable outcomes.
  • Meet regularly with clients representing our team, so strong client-facing skills are essential.
  • Translate business objectives into clear requirements and acceptance criteria; ensure tickets are unambiguous and testable. Demonstrated ability to produce logic (truth tables, etc).
  • Keep abreast of the rapidly developing use and deployment of AI tools and techniques, and collaborate with your team and company leadership to integrate this knowledge into our approach.
  • Coordinate across disciplines to ensure data readiness, evaluate and integrate AI model outputs, and ensure alignment with explainability, trust, and governance practices.
  • Plan and track work (milestones, risks, assumptions, issues, and dependencies), budgets, and delivery signals (e.g., burnup/burndown, velocity).
  • Mitigate risks proactively; lead issue triage and escalation paths.
  • Coordinate the day-to-day work of our engineers, designers, and product leaders, and work with client partners to ensure seamless collaboration and quality delivery.
  • Partner with account leaders to manage scope and client expectations (draft SOWs, identify scope changes, identify opportunities for growth, escape issues, validate invoices, etc.).
  • Willing to do what is needed to help the company succeed. Partner with company leadership to help draft new business proposals, RFPs, and participate in new business pitches.
What You’ll Bring
  • 4+ years of software product management / development experience or in a related role in a consultancy/agency or product organization delivering custom software.
  • People like working with you. You are the type of person who engenders trust and confidence.
  • The ability to understand the client’s real goals and constraints in order to focus your team on identifying opportunities and unlocking business value.
  • The ability to rapidly understand new business models and product ideas.
  • Strong command of agile delivery (usually Scrum or Kanban), while being flexible to the requirements of our clients. You are a Jira expert (though there are some new and interesting alternatives), and adept at managing backlogs, epics, sprints, tickets, releases… and expectations.
  • Technical fluency, including familiarity with common tools and technology stacks; comfortable collaborating with engineering leads.
  • Design fluency, including design thinking, rapid prototyping, UX, and familiarity with common tools (e.g., Figma); comfortable collaborating with product and design leads.
  • Experience coordinating with cross-functional teams (engineering, design, business), including distributed collaborators.
  • Exposure to regulated domains (e.g., healthtech, fintech, govtech, edtech) is a plus.
  • Excellent written communication skills. Using AI is great, but you know how to make sure outputs say what you actually mean them to say, with clarity and good taste. This means you could do it yourself, independent of AI.
  • The ideal candidate probably has prior, hands‑on experience as a software/data engineer, UX/UI designer, or product manager embedded in a software development team.
How We Work (and what you can expect)
  • Regulated-industry rigor: healthcare, government, and financial services engagements often include compliance-oriented processes and documentation.
  • AI & Data focus: AI-native product experiences and robust data platforms/analytics when they create measurable value.
  • Mainly remote work: seeking candidates in the greater Los Angeles area to mainly work remotely with some on-site work required at times.
